Shot San Jacinto last Weds, had B3 on the big pond. Me and my buddy Mark had busted 5 birds within the first 30 minutes, and had 2 limits and off the pond by 10:30. BUT! We were in the spot where they wanted to be AND we were the only blind with NO spinners and only 9 dekes! Less is more sometimes! The wind kicked up, which brought in flocks of bulls, widgeon groups, and some gaddies in singles/pairs.
Then hunted Kern Saturday with two friends. Missed a few birds, but I'll tell you, for mid-December there were very few birds and very little shooting! I was disappointed but hey, that's why it's huntin' and not killin', right?
Birds are out there, just be ready to think out of the box. Maybe it's just a pair of mallards, 5 bulls, and a couple teal dekes...and make sure you've got some movement in your spread. Maybe it's just a couple teal and a pair of mallards. And, <gasp>, no calling! Mix it up and be ready to be mobile. If you're not where the ducks want to be, go to them. Maybe ditch the dekes and break a sweat moving some tule patches out of your way~you'll be surprised what's hiding inside that thick stand of impassable green!
